Transaction 3b5a90544270001e3eaca92c74f1a3bce764b856a19800b9605b45e6c1ae36e9
1 Input
1 Output
-
3b5a90544270001e3eaca92c74f1a3bce764b856a19800b9605b45e6c1ae36e9:0
- value
- 40044792
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efa496989c309a0062471f221556195b9b44950f OP_EQUAL
- address
- 3PY8bBehtFm8QG8mZ4nhftL51gYun3sPz3